Terms in this set (13)
Hide definitions
Redox Reactions
Involve electron transfer between molecules, combining oxidation and reduction processes.
Oxidation
The process of losing one or more electrons, increasing the overall charge.
Reduction
The process of gaining one or more electrons, decreasing the overall charge.
Electron
A negatively charged subatomic particle involved in redox reactions.
Electron Carrier
Molecules like NADH and FADH2 that transport electrons within cells.
NADH
A reduced electron carrier that transports electrons and hydrogen ions.
FADH2
A reduced electron carrier that transports electrons and hydrogen ions.
NAD+
The oxidized form of NADH, having fewer electrons.
FAD
The oxidized form of FADH2, having fewer electrons.
Electron Transport Chain
The final stage of cellular respiration where electrons are transferred.
Cellular Respiration
A biological process involving redox reactions to produce energy.
Hydrogen Ion
A positively charged ion that accompanies electrons in redox reactions.
Mnemonic
A memory aid, such as 'Leo the lion goes ger' for redox reactions.
